Understanding the systems that drive cellular repair illuminates prospective strategies for mitigating the indications of aging. Cellular repair includes a number of essential processes:
DNA Repair: Cells have elaborate systems to repair DNA damage. Improved DNA repair is an important element of maintaining cell practicality and function and is a centerpiece in anti-aging research study.
Autophagy: This process involves the destruction and recycling of damaged cellular components. By promoting autophagy, cells can clear out dysfunctional proteins and organelles, contributing to improved cellular health.
Stem Cell Activation: As people age, the activity of stem cells declines. Methods to renew or activate stem cells supply appealing avenues for promoting tissue repair and regrowth.
Sirtuin Activation: Sirtuins are a household of proteins that play a main role in cellular health through their involvement in DNA repair, swelling, and metabolism. Triggering sirtuins through particular compounds or lifestyle changes may support healthy aging.
Latest Breakthroughs in Anti-Aging Research
Recent advancements in anti-aging cellular repair research highlight exciting possibilities for people looking for to fend off the effects of aging:
NAD+ Boosters: NAD+ (Nicotinamide adenine dinucleotide) is vital for cellular basal metabolism and DNA repair. Studies show that supplements like NMN (Nicotinamide mononucleotide) and NR (Nicotinamide riboside) can help renew NAD+ levels in aging cells.
Senolytics: These substances are developed to selectively get rid of senescent cells, therefore decreasing persistent swelling and promoting healthier aging. Early-stage research study shows pledge for enhancing cellular health in older individuals.
Gene Therapy: Techniques that target and right genetic mutations related to aging offer new vistas in the fight against age-related degeneration. Gene editing platforms like CRISPR hold possible in cellular renewal.

What is cellular senescence?
Cellular senescence is the procedure by which cells cease to divide and function properly. While this process can prevent the expansion of broken cells, the build-up of senescent cells can add to age-related diseases and inflammation.
2. How can I boost my cellular repair mechanisms?
Enhancing cellular repair can be attained through a combination of healthy lifestyle choices such as keeping a well balanced diet plan, taking part in routine exercise, handling stress, and making sure adequate sleep.
3. Exist supplements that support anti-aging cellular repair?
Yes, specific supplements like NAD+ boosters (such as NMN and NR), anti-oxidants, and other substances targeting sirtuins and autophagy pathways are being checked out in research for their capacity in boosting cellular repair and promoting healthy aging.
4. Can way of life aspects affect DNA repair systems?
Definitely. Lifestyle aspects, including diet plan, exercise, and direct exposure to ecological toxic substances, can substantially affect the efficiency of DNA repair mechanisms in cells.
5. What role does autophagy play in anti-aging?
Autophagy is crucial for the deterioration and recycling of harmed cell parts. It helps maintain cellular health by avoiding the accumulation of dysfunctional proteins and organelles, thereby playing a crucial role in anti-aging.
